Background

Cinema City is a Chinese cinema chain founded in 2014 by Raymond Wong. It is not to be confused with the other Cinema City companies, which are completely unrelated.

Logo (2014-)

Visuals: There is 2 C's spinning like a sphere, with their reflections above. They come together in one direction, and spin for a little before moving left and right. CINEMA CITY forms afterward, as the golden glare in the background dies down.

Audio: A bling sound effect followed by a quiet choir theme, ending with a single piano note.

Availability: Seen as a bumper on the films shown in their cinema, including The First Girl I Loved, The Addams Family 2, and My Country, My Parents. It is also seen as a print logo on the bottom left of their website.
